Area contextNeighborhood Overview – Pittsfield State Forest State Park (Pittsfield, MA)
Nestled in the heart of the Berkshire Mountains, Pittsfield State Forest State Park is a significant natural landmark within Pittsfield, Massachusetts. Its primary access is from Cascade Street, which winds its way into the park's core. The park is situated a few miles west of downtown Pittsfield, offering a sense of seclusion while remaining conveniently close to urban amenities. Major routes like US-7 and MA-20 provide access to Pittsfield, with local roads leading directly to the park entrance. Albany International Airport (ALB) is the nearest major airport, approximately an hour's drive to the northwest, while smaller regional airports may offer limited options. Driving is the most practical way to reach the park, and visitors should be aware of seasonal road conditions. During peak foliage season or summer weekends, local roads leading to popular natural areas can experience moderate traffic, making an early arrival advisable to secure parking within the forest and enjoy a more serene experience. Parking within the park is generally available at various trailheads and scenic overlooks, but spaces can fill up, especially during popular times of the year.

Balance Rock Trail
This popular trail offers a moderate loop through mixed hardwood forest, culminating in the impressive Balanced Rock, a large glacial erratic. The trail is well-marked and provides a good introduction to the park's diverse flora and fauna. It’s an ideal choice for a shorter hike, allowing visitors to experience the forest's beauty without committing to a full day of trekking. Look for various bird species and enjoy the peaceful sounds of the woods as you explore this accessible path. The trail is suitable for most fitness levels and is a highlight for many park visitors.

The Mount, Edith Wharton's Home
Step back in time at The Mount, the beautifully preserved estate of acclaimed author Edith Wharton. Tour her elegant home, stroll through the stunning Gilded Age gardens she designed, and explore the visitor center and bookstore. This National Historic Landmark offers a fascinating glimpse into Wharton's life and literary world. It’s a cultural cornerstone of the Berkshires, providing a serene and inspiring experience for history buffs and garden enthusiasts alike. Seasonal events and guided tours are often available, enhancing the visitor experience.

Lenox · 6.1 miLocal Tips & Year-Round Info
- Traffic on routes leading into Pittsfield can be heavier during weekday commuting hours, especially on MA-20 and US-7.
- Fall foliage season (late September to mid-October) brings significant crowds to the park and surrounding towns, so plan accordingly.
- Many smaller rural roads in the area are winding and may have limited lighting at night; drive cautiously after dark.
- Cell service can be spotty within Pittsfield State Forest, so download maps and information beforehand.
- Local shops and restaurants may have reduced hours or be closed on Mondays and Tuesdays in off-peak seasons.
Weather & Seasons at Pittsfield State Forest State Park
- Winter: Winter in Pittsfield State Forest brings cold temperatures, often with significant snowfall, creating a quiet, picturesque landscape. Average highs are in the 20s and 30s Fahrenheit, with lows dropping below freezing. Visitors should be prepared for icy conditions on trails and plan for potentially challenging driving due to snow. Warm, waterproof layers, insulated boots, and hats are essential. Outdoor activities may be limited to snowshoeing or cross-country skiing on accessible trails.
- Spring & early summer: Spring brings a gradual warming trend, with temperatures ranging from cool to mild, typically in the 40s and 50s Fahrenheit in early spring, warming to the 60s and 70s by early summer. Expect rain showers as the weather transitions. Trails can be wet and muddy, especially in shaded areas. Lightweight, waterproof outer layers and sturdy, water-resistant footwear are recommended. Wildflowers begin to bloom, and the forest awakens with greenery.
- Mid-summer: Mid-summer is typically warm to hot and humid, with average daytime temperatures in the 70s and 80s Fahrenheit, though heatwaves can push temperatures higher. Sunny days are common, interspersed with occasional thunderstorms. Light, breathable clothing is best, along with sun protection like hats and sunscreen. Staying hydrated is crucial, especially during hikes. Mosquitoes and other insects can be present, so insect repellent is advisable.
- Fall season: Fall is characterized by crisp, cool air and stunning foliage, with temperatures generally ranging from the 50s to 60s Fahrenheit. Mornings and evenings can be chilly, requiring layers. The vibrant colors draw large crowds, and the weather is often ideal for hiking. Pack comfortable walking shoes, light jackets, and perhaps a warmer sweater for cooler evenings.
